I ran the new 211 f/w yesterday with great results. The track was a parking lot setup, a desent size with mostly fast sweepers & a couple of tight corners.
I'm glad to report that we swept the event in the modified class. We were averaging a second per lap faster than anyone else.I don't know what motors the others were running, but I was running my Novak SS 13.5 with just a touch of endbell timing added. The rest was my 120a Xerun with the 211 f/w.
So here's the setting I ran.

MOTOR: NOVAK SS 13.5
FDR: 8.68
F/W: 211
MOTOR TEMPS: 101
ESC TEMPS: 85
RUNNING MODE: FORWARD/BRAKE/REVERSE
DRAG BRAKE: 0%
VOLTAGE PROTECT: CUSTOM 6.2
DDRS: LEVEL 7
BRAKE FORCE: 87.5%
REVERSE FORCE: 50%
INITIAL BRAKE: 0%
NEUTRAL RANGE: 6%
BOOST TIMING: 30
TURBO SLOPE: 18 UNITS/0.1 SEC
OVERHEAT PROTECT: ON
TURBO TIMING: 30
BOOST START RPM: 4000 RPM
TURBO DELAY: 0.3 SEC
TIMING ACC/SLOPE: 350 RPM/UNIT

Next week I may try my SS 17.5 with the same settings, but different fdr.

cherry2blost 04-03-2011 07:13 PM


Originally Posted by zamrioo2 (Post 8908220)
cherry... it's capable to run more than 64?

No 64 is the limit, but using that it gains as muchtiming as it needs before the Turbo hits. Lets say, that after I had been a full throttle for 0.8s then say 50 degrees of timing had been added then the turbo would only add 14. Just means for a big track allows the motor to stretch its' legs before the turbo comes in. Also if you never quite hit full throttle then there is the opportunity for the motor to ramp up to full timing on boost without turbo.

Another by-product of these settings is on a long sweeper, if you have to lay off a bit you don't have to wait for the turbo to come back on just floor it and the timing carries on adding until the 0.8s is up then adds the Turbo.

Please don't copy my settings to closely as I am a pretty heavy handed aggressive driver. These suit my driving style very well. BTW this was on the following gearing.

28T Pinion 70T Spur with an internal of 2.4375 6.09:1 track is HUGE and pretty much flat out all the way round.
